Hello,

I'm getting interrupt storm lately.
...
But still same issue with irq0: clk but less now.

IM# vmstat -i
interrupt total rate
irq0: clk 37009569 1000

So far, you haven't provided any evidence of any "interrupt storm" or
how it might be related to acpi. And 7.0 isn't stable yet.

The default HZ is 1000 so unless you explicitly change it in your
kernel config, you should have 1000 clock interrupts/sec.
